Investment platforms must adapt to local market conditions and regional regulations to operate legally and meet investor expectations. Every country has unique financial laws, tax requirements, investment preferences, and payment systems. Compliance helps avoid legal penalties while building trust among users. Localization, including language, currency, and customer support, improves accessibility and user experience. Platforms should also tailor investment products to regional economic conditions and cultural preferences, such as mutual funds in India or ETFs in the United States.
